COVID-19 Exclusions For Thoroughbred Park, Canberra Races (Friday 23rd July)

Canberra Racing Club wishes to advise that participants, horses and patrons travelling from the Greater Sydney area will be excluded from the race meeting scheduled for Friday 23rd July at Thoroughbred Park.

The Club will continue to work with ACT Health and Racing NSW to ensure the safety of participants, patrons and the wider community.

Trainers are encouraged to consider jockey locations when making bookings ahead of this upcoming race meeting.
